Next season, we will be implementing a new MINOR LEAGUE using the qualification championship from next season. With that, we can now start the brand new MAJOR/MINOR PROMOTION/RELEGATION SYSTEM!
The bottom 2 teams from the major league will play the top two teams from the minor league.
#10 majors will play #1 minors #9 majors will play #2 minors
If #10 wins, they will stay in If #1 wins, they will replace #10
Same with 9 and 2
OR WE CAN DO...
Just the whole top two replace the bottom two without the playoff at the end. |
